Karachi Heats Up as Sea Breeze Stalls

Temperature May Ease Slightly from Friday, Says Met Office

May 29, 2025

KARACHI: The Pakistan Meteorological Department has forecast a further spike in Karachi’s temperatures starting today (Thursday), as sea breezes are expected to weaken over the next 48 hours.

Hot, dry winds from the west are likely to sweep through the city today and tomorrow, pushing temperatures up and creating heatwave-like conditions. Wind speeds may reach 35 to 40 kilometres per hour on Thursday, amplifying the heat’s intensity.

Daytime temperatures are expected to hover between 39°C and 41°C on both Thursday and Friday. May is typically one of the hottest months for Karachi, often placing it among the warmest cities in the region.

However, a slight drop in temperature is anticipated from Friday onwards, offering some relief from the sweltering heat.
